区块链技术近年来得到了广泛的应用,特别是在金融领域,作为一种去中心化的分布式账本技术,它以其透明性和不可篡改性赢得了市场的青睐。然而,尽管区块链在许多方面看似安全,但其交易安全问题依然显得尤为重要和复杂。本文将深入探讨区块链交易的安全问题,包括潜在的风险、挑战以及可能的解决方案。
区块链的基本特性使其在传统交易中能够实现透明和信任,但在现实应用中,交易安全问题却层出不穷。很多人认为区块链是绝对安全的,但实际上,它也存在着诸如黑客攻击、智能合约漏洞、私钥管理等多种安全隐患。此外,区块链技术的高复杂性导致其安全性极易受到攻击者的威胁。
区块链交易的安全问题主要集中在以下几个方面:
黑客攻击是影响区块链交易安全的最明显威胁之一。区块链网络的去中心化特性使其在理论上难以被攻击,但实际操作中,黑客可以利用多种方法进行攻击。例如,针对某些区块链交易所的交易平台,黑客可能通过漏洞入侵系统,盗取用户资产。根据数据显示,区块链和加密货币行业的黑客攻击事件频繁发生,给许多投资者造成了巨大损失。
为了防止黑客攻击,区块链项目需要加强网络安全基础设施,进行定期的安全审计。此外,采用多重签名和冷钱包储存可以大幅度提高资产的安全性。
智能合约是自动执行合约的程序,但其代码的复杂性也容易引发问题。智能合约中的小小错误就可能导致巨大的财产损失。例如,2016年的DAO事件中,黑客利用智能合约漏洞成功盗取了价值5000万美元的以太币。智能合约的部署前进行全面的安全审计和测试是至关重要的。
项目团队需要加强对智能合约代码的审查,并利用自动化的工具进行漏洞检测,确保合约的安全性。同时,开发者应该熟悉常见的攻击手法,并结合实际情况设计出更安全的合约。
私钥是用户控制区块链资产的关键。私钥的丢失或被盗会导致数字资产的不可逆转损失。许多用户由于缺乏安全意识,未能妥善保管自己的私钥,最终导致财产损失。
为了规范私钥管理,用户需要选择合适的存储方式,如使用硬件钱包、冷钱包等安全性较高的储存方式,避免将私钥存放于易受攻击的网络环境中。此外,用户也需定期备份自己的私钥和助记词,以避免因设备损坏而导致的资产丢失。
51%攻击是指当一个攻击者或一个组织控制了超过50%的网络算力时,就可以对区块链进行操控,篡改交易记录。虽然这种攻击在大型区块链网络中难度较大,但在一些小型的区块链网络上,现实中却也能出现。
为了防范51%攻击,区块链项目需要增强算力分布的多样性,并通过不断吸引更多的节点参与网络,增加攻击者实施攻破的成本。而对于用户而言,选择具有良好声誉和强大共识机制的区块链网络也是保护自己资产的一种方式。
用户自身的行为也是区块链交易安全的重要环节。钓鱼攻击和社交工程欺诈等方式常常利用用户的信任来获取敏感信息。例如,通过假冒网站或链接,诱使用户输入私钥或密码,从而导致财产损失。
为了改善这一现象,用户需要增强安全意识,定期参加安全培训,了解常见的网络犯罪手法,提高对可疑行为的警惕性。同时,区块链项目也可以开发用户教育平台,通过在线课程、视频等方式提升用户的安全知识。
区块链交易的安全问题不容忽视,需要多方面的努力来解决。通过完善技术安全措施、加强用户安全意识和教育、以及健全区块链生态系统,可以有效降低交易安全风险。随着技术的发展和应用的普及,预计将会有更多的安全协议和监管政策出台,为区块链行业创造一个更为安全的环境。
区块链交易安全的最佳实践是防范风险、降低损失的关键。这些实践包括:实施多层安全措施,如多重签名、冷钱包存储;定期进行安全审计和代码审查;对用户进行安全教育等。同时,保持软件和程序及时更新,修补已知漏洞。
以下是一些具体的最佳实践:
提升区块链交易安全可通过多种技术手段来实现:
市场上有许多知名的区块链安全解决方案,这些解决方案提供了多种功能来保护交易安全。以下是一些主要的安全产品和服务:
未来的安全发展趋势将受到多种因素影响,以下是一些可能的重要方向:
增强用户的安全意识至关重要,以确保区块链交易的安全。以下是一些实践:
通过以上方法,可以有效提高用户对区块链交易安全的重视,从而为整个生态系统的安全性提供保障。
随着区块链技术的不断发展和成熟,针对交易安全问题的研究也在深入。希望这篇文章能为对区块链交易安全感兴趣的读者提供有益的信息和指导,帮助大家更好地理解和应对安全挑战。